10P1
CHECK EXHAUST SYSTEM.
: Are there holes or loose bolts on exhaust
system?
: Repair exhaust system.
: Go to step10P2.
10P2
CHECK AIR INTAKE SYSTEM.
: Are there holes, loose bolts or disconnec-
tion of hose on air intake system?
: Repair air intake system.
: Go to step10P3.
G2M0340
10P3
CHECK FUEL PRESSURE.
1) Release fuel pressure.
(1) Remove fuel pump access hole lid located on the
right rear of trunk compartment floor (Sedan) or lug-
gage compartment floor (Wagon).
B2M0047
(2) Disconnect connector from fuel tank.
(3) Start the engine, and run it until it stalls.
(4) After stopping the engine, crank the engine for 5 to
7 seconds to reduce fuel pressure.
(5) Turn ignition switch to OFF.
B2M0047
2) Connect connector to fuel tank.

OBD0711
3) Disconnect fuel delivery hose from fuel filter, and con-
nect fuel pressure gauge.
G2M0348
4) Start the engine and idle while gear position is neutral.
5) Measure fuel pressure while disconnecting pressure
regulator vacuum hose from intake manifold.
: Is fuel pressure between 226 and 275 kPa
(2.3—2.8 kg/cm2,33—40 psi)?
: Go to next step 6).
: Repair the following items.
Fuel pressure too highClogged fuel return line or bent
hose
Fuel pressure too lowImproper fuel pump discharge
Clogged fuel supply line
6) After connecting pressure regulator vacuum hose, mea-
sure fuel pressure.
: Is fuel pressure between 157 and 206 kPa
(1.6—2.1 kg/cm2,23—30 psi)?
: Go to step10P4.
: Repair the following items.
Fuel pressure too highFaulty pressure regulator
Clogged fuel return line or bent
hose
Fuel pressure too lowFaulty pressure regulator
Improper fuel pump discharge
Clogged fuel supply line
WARNING:
Before removing fuel pressure gauge, release fuel
pressure.
NOTE:
If fuel pressure does not increase, squeeze fuel return
hose 2 to 3 times, then measure fuel pressure again.
If out of specification as measured at step 6), check or
replace pressure regulator and pressure regulator vacuum
hose.
